Dravite Vs Grossular Garnet Luster

A primary knowledge about Dravite vs Grossular Garnet luster is useful in apparent identifications of these gemstones. Luster is the measure of light that gets reflected when incident on a finished cut gemstone. There are two major types of lusters: Silky and Adamantine. Since luster varies between two crystals of even the same gemstone, luster is limited to basic identification criteria. Dravite exhibits Vitreous luster. Grossular Garnet, on other hand, exhibits Vitreous and Adamantine luster.
